|
numerics
|
This is the complete list of members for num::Circuit, including all inherited members.
| ccx(int c0, int c1, int tgt) | num::Circuit | |
| Circuit(int n_qubits) | num::Circuit | explicit |
| cp(real lambda, int ctrl, int tgt) | num::Circuit | |
| cswap(int ctrl, int q0, int q1) | num::Circuit | |
| cx(int ctrl, int tgt) | num::Circuit | |
| cy(int ctrl, int tgt) | num::Circuit | |
| cz(int ctrl, int tgt) | num::Circuit | |
| diagram() const | num::Circuit | |
| gate(const quantum::Gate &G, int q, std::string label="U") | num::Circuit | |
| gate(const quantum::Gate2Q &G, int q0, int q1, std::string label="U2") | num::Circuit | |
| h(int q) | num::Circuit | |
| n_gates() const | num::Circuit | inline |
| n_qubits() const | num::Circuit | inline |
| p(real lambda, int q) | num::Circuit | |
| print() const | num::Circuit | |
| run(int shots=1024, unsigned seed=42) const | num::Circuit | |
| rx(real theta, int q) | num::Circuit | |
| ry(real theta, int q) | num::Circuit | |
| rz(real theta, int q) | num::Circuit | |
| s(int q) | num::Circuit | |
| sdg(int q) | num::Circuit | |
| statevector() const | num::Circuit | |
| statevector_at(int n) const | num::Circuit | |
| swap(int q0, int q1) | num::Circuit | |
| t(int q) | num::Circuit | |
| tdg(int q) | num::Circuit | |
| u(real theta, real phi, real lambda, int q) | num::Circuit | |
| views() const | num::Circuit | |
| x(int q) | num::Circuit | |
| y(int q) | num::Circuit | |
| z(int q) | num::Circuit |